FAO strengthens agricultural statistics across Africa to support better decisions on food and ...
Accra, Ghana – Reliable agricultural data is helping African countries make better decisions on food security, agricultural development and sustainable agrifood systems. During the 2024–2025 biennium, the FAO Regional Office for Africa expanded technical support across the continent, helping countries strengthen agricultural statistics, improve national data systems and build the evidence needed for policy and investment. Working across 47 African countries, the FAO Regional Office for Africa supports governments to collect, analyse and use agricultural data through national agricultural censuses and surveys, Food Balance Sheets, Sustainable Development Goal (SDG) monitoring and statistical capacity development. These efforts help countries generate the information needed to monitor national priorities, regional commitments and global development agendas. During the biennium, FAO supported: 24 countries to conduct national agricultural surveys through the 50x2030 Initiative, expanding the availability of high-quality agricultural data. 16 countries to prepare or implement national agricultural censuses, strengthening the foundation for long-term agricultural statistics. 15 countries to compile national Food Balance Sheets, providing comprehensive information on food availability, dietary energy, proteins, fats and other nutrients to support food security and nutrition planning. 18 countries to strengthen monitoring and reporting of agriculture-related Sustainable Development Goal indicators. FAO Strengthens Agricultural Data Collection and Analysis in Africa
The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) is helping African countries improve agricultural data collection and analysis to support better decisions on food security, agricultural development and sustainable agrifood systems. During the 2024–2025 biennium, the FAO Regional Office for Africa expanded its technical assistance across 47 countries, strengthening national statistical systems and improving the quality of information used for policymaking and investment. Reliable agricultural data plays an important role in helping governments understand production trends, food availability and rural development needs, allowing them to plan more effectively and respond to emerging challenges. Support Expands Across 47 Countries Over the two-year period, FAO supported 24 countries in conducting national agricultural surveys through the 50x2030 Initiative, improving the availability of high-quality agricultural data. Another 16 countries received assistance in preparing or implementing national agricultural censuses, creating a stronger foundation for long-term agricultural statistics. The organisation also helped 15 countries compile Food Balance Sheets, which provide detailed information on food availability, dietary energy, protein, fats and other nutrients. These datasets support national planning for food security and nutrition while helping governments monitor changes in food supply. Cultivating Safety: The Role of Sound Agricultural Practices in Sustainable Food Systems
Food safety and food security are often mentioned together, yet they refer to two distinct but closely connected challenges. Food safety ensures that food is free from contamination, harmful residues and other hazards, while food security means that everyone has reliable access to sufficient, nutritious and affordable food. The two are inseparable. Access to food has little value if that food is unsafe to eat. Building safe, resilient food systems therefore requires the collective commitment of everyone in the agricultural value chain – from farmers to policymakers and consumers. It calls for continuous innovation, collaboration and, above all, responsible farming practices season after season. Farmers play a central role in protecting both consumer health and the long-term sustainability of food production. By adopting smart crop protection practices alongside responsible land management, they can safeguard their harvests while protecting the natural resources on which future production depends. The result is safe, high-quality food for consumers and healthier soils, cleaner water and stronger biodiversity for the seasons ahead. Modern agriculture is evolving rapidly. Precision agriculture, digital technologies, biological solutions and resilient crop varieties enable farmers to protect crops more effectively while using fewer, more targeted inputs.
